  • Purpose - Since the opening of Korea's distribution market, the domestic network marketing market has been continuing to grow. In this context, research on network marketing independent operators, which plays the most important role in the network marketing industry, is insufficient. This study was to identify the effects of Independent Operator's Company Selection Attributions on the Economic and Non-Economic Satisfaction, Trust, and Recommendation. The results will provide strategic direction, theoretical and practical implications for companies and operators in the network marketing industry. Research design, data, and methodology - In order to verify the research hypotheses, the data were collected from Independent Operators of Network marketing industry using questionnaires. The pretest was conducted from January 8 to 19, 2018, and the main survey was conducted from February 1 to 28. A total of 210 questionnaires, of which 193 copies were collected. The data were analyzed with SPSS 21.0. and AMOS 21.0. Results - The results are as follows; product competitiveness and system competitiveness have significant effects on economic satisfaction and non-economic satisfaction. Economic and non-economic satisfaction have significant effects on business trust. Economic and non-economic satisfaction did not influence recommendation intention directly, but influence it indirectly. Business trust has a significant effect on business recommendation intention. Conclusions - After starting network marketing business as an independent operator, the competitiveness of the company is meaningless, and product competitiveness and system competitiveness are important factors for economic and non-economic satisfaction. Therefore, network marketing companies and independent operators should prioritize product competitiveness and system competitiveness between business development. The findings show that trust in the business is very important for active business Recommendation to others. Therefore, network marketing firms and independent operators need to make efforts to meet economic and non-economic satisfaction, which have a significant impact on business trust.

Caffe Bene: Creating Values for Customers

  • Caffe Bene, one of the most notable coffeehouse chain brands in Republic of Korea, gives us some thought-provoking issues in terms of sustainable success. Despite harsh competition among various coffeehouse brands, Caffe Bene has been accomplished astonishing outcomes in domestic market and now ranked 2nd place in sales among the global coffeehouse franchise in 2010 and 2011. These achievements were possible mainly because Caffe Bene adopted distinctive shop design, maintained aggressive marketing strategy, developed new menu, and combined the unique Korean culture with ordinary concept of café to make its place attractive. However, since Korean coffeehouse market is getting saturated and consumers are becoming savvy about coffee, Caffe Bene needs to find a new solution to overcome growth stagnation. Besides, many experts pointed out that irrational increase in the number of stores might hurt its business in the aspect of managing distribution channel and providing consistent services. Also, customers of Caffe Bene have shown that it has to complement its critical weaknesses: inferior coffee taste and relatively high price for a cup of coffee. Especially, some people view that the company is shifting its high rental fee, interior cost and PPL marketing cost to consumers by charging high price for coffee. To get over the problems, Caffe Bene is currently using C/S Consumer Management System though experts are questioning about the efficacy because of the conflict between purpose of the system and the headquarters' plan. Present CEO Kim also announced that the company will complete its logistics system in the latter half of 2012 to provide stores with more high quality coffee beans to improve taste of coffee. Thus, in this case, we describe how Caffe Bene succeeded in Korean market and enumerate its key success factors. Also, we specify the long-term goals of Caffe Bene and introduce the current policies and strategies to show how the company is working on to achieve its ultimate goal. By reading and analyzing this business case, students could get useful insights regarding franchise management and think about issues on competing in a saturated market. Also, it would be worthwhile to generate creative solutions for the problems that Caffe Bene is now facing to broaden the practical perspective.

  • 프랜차이즈 시스템은 제2차 세계대전 이후 유통경로의 중요한 한 분야로서 미국을 시작으로 급속한 성장세를 보여 왔다. 미국과 일본을 거쳐 국내에는 1979년에 도입되어 비약적인 성장과 발전을 이루었다. 현재 한국의 프랜차이즈 시스템은 미국적 계약문화에 의한 지적재산권으로 정착되기 보다는 한국문화에 맞는 사업경쟁력 강화시스템으로 변형, 발전 되었는데 한국의 프랜차이즈 시스템은 가맹본부가 가맹점으로부터 로열티를 받는 대신 대량구매와 공동물류, 마케팅을 활용한 경쟁력을 높여 이에 따른 이익을 발생시키는 독특한 시스템으로 정착되었다. 이러한 한국적 프랜차이즈 시스템의 국내 성공에 힘입어 최근 국내의 많은 프랜차이즈 업체들이 한국적 프랜차이즈 시스템에 의한 국제경쟁력을 갖추고 해외 진출을 본격적으로 전개하고 있다. 이런 한국의 프랜차이즈 기업의 해외진출은 한국 내에서 지역을 넓혀가는 것에 비해 훨씬 많은 시간과 조사, 노력, 자금이 필요하고 이에 따르는 위험도도 높다. 즉 진출하고자 하는 국가의 문화, 관습, 생활수준 및 관련 법규에 대하여 충분한 조사를 행한 후에야 진출 여부에 대한 의사 결정을 내릴 수가 있다. 최근 카페베네가 미국 뉴욕 맨해튼에 진출하고 번 전문업체도 미국 현지에서 성공적으로 안착하는 등 국내 토종 프랜차이즈 기업들도 해외 진출을 통하여 사업을 확대하고 있는 추세다. 그러나 영국시장에서 우리나라 프랜차이즈 진출은 전무한 상태다. 영국의 경우는 개인 서비스 영역의 프랜차이즈의 성장세가 높아지고 있고 웰빙 열풍으로 동양의 식음료에 대한 정보도 유입되고 있는 상황이다. 또한 유럽국가 중에서도 인터넷 보급률이 높으며 2012년 런던올림픽 이후 IT 산업 육성 등 홍보나 마케팅 정보의 유입이 예전에 비해 좀 더 쉽게 다가갈 수 있게 되었다. 이러한 상황에서 영국 시장에 프랜차이즈 진출을 위하여 사업 환경은 어떠한지 어떠한 업종으로 진출할 것인지의 전략수립을 통하여 세밀하게 성공 요인을 분석하고 벤치마킹함으로써 한국의 프랜차이즈 기업이 영국 시장 진출에 큰 시사점을 얻을 수 있는데 그 목적이 있다.

The Effect of Marketing Activities on the Brand Recognition, Brand Familiarity, and Purchase Intention on the SNS of Franchise Companies

  • The purpose of this study is to find out how SNS marketing activities affect brand recognition, brand familiarity, and purchase intention for consumers who have purchased products from franchise chicken stores, including whether there is a moderating effect according to gender. SNS marketing activities were set up by configuring three attributes which are, SNS advertising, SNS information, and SNS events as sub-factors. For empirical analysis, a survey was conducted on SNS users, and SPSS/AMOS statistical programs were employed for the data analysis. First, the result of the empirical analysis showed that SNS advertising, SNS information, and SNS events have a significant positive effect on brand recognition. Second, it was found that the SNS events had a significant positive effect on brand familiarity. Third, it was found that SNS advertising has a significant positive effect on purchase intention. Fourth, it was observed that brand recognition has a significant positive effect on brand familiarity. Fifth, it was found that brand recognition and brand familiarity have a significant positive effect on purchase intention. Sixth, it was found that gender plays a significant role in the relationship between these constructs. Therefore, it can be assumed that the hypothesis presented in this study is sufficiently proven.

Impacts of Marketing Capabilities on Competitive Advantage and Business Performance: Application of IPMA

  • Purpose: Based on the resource-based view and the competitive advantage theory, the study views marketing capabilities (product, pricing, delivery/inventory, and promotional support) as sources of competitive advantage (differentiation advantage and low-cost advantage) and examines their impacts on competitive advantage, which in turn, will influence non-business and business performance. Research design, data and methodology: Data were collected from 149 representatives of franchising companies in South Korea and analyzed with SmartPLS 3.3.7. Results: First, promotional support and product have a significant impact on differentiation advantage. Second, pricing and promotional support have a significant impact on low-cost advantage. Third, differentiation advantage has an influence on non-financial and financial business performance. Fourth, low-cost advantage has an impact on non-financial performance but has no significant direct impact on financial performance. Fifth, non-financial performance is related to financial performance. Finally, the result of IPMA shows that importance and performance values of exogeneous variables are different depending on firm size. Conclusions: The findings suggest that franchisors should focus on different marketing capabilities depending on their strategic focus and objectives. Finally, the findings based on an IPMA suggest that small companies perceive low-cost advantage as important, while their counterparts do not. Several theoretical and managerial implications are offered.

Determinants of Opportunism between Franchisor and Franchisee: Focusing on the Moderating Effect of Startup Experience

  • Purpose: This study examines the opportunism moderating effect by the startup experience in the relationship between franchisor and franchisees. In the case of a franchise system that has a continuous relational exchange transaction, relationship management is a very important activity because the relationship management between franchisor and franchisees improves the quality of the relationship. Nevertheless, there is insufficient of research on opportunism, which is a negative factor in managing the relationship between franchisor and franchisees in continuous relationship. Research design, data and methodology: This study, we explore the cause of opportunism based on transaction cost theory through prior research and establish a research model based by goal incongruity, uncertainty, information asymmetry, transaction specific assets, the relevance to determinant of opportunism and the startup experienced which is a moderating variable. To verify several hypotheses, the data were collected from 300 out of 1,760 domestic franchisees and analyzed using multiple regression analysis with SPSS program. Results: The findings are as follows. Goal incongruity did not affect opportunism. Opportunism increased as uncertainty increased, and as information asymmetry increased, opportunism increased. An opportunism decreased as transaction specific assets increased. Moreover, the findings show that startup experience only plays a moderating role in the relationship between information asymmetry and opportunism. Therefore, 4 out of 8 hypotheses were supported. Conclusions: The findings show that uncertainty, information asymmetry, and transaction specific assets are the determinants of opportunism. In addition, the results of the analysis of the moderating role of startup experience show that the less entrepreneurial experience, the greater the influence of information asymmetry on opportunism. Our findings mean that maintaining a successful relationship between franchisors and franchisees is possible when franchisors provide knowledge sharing, goal sharing, environmental sharing, and management information sharing to franchisees. In addition, the findings of this study shows that the contract content and management should be changed according to the entrepreneurial experience. In other words, the franchisors must share and integrate the accumulated franchisees' and franchisors' experience with the franchisees to create a synergy that can lead to successful bilateral relationship maintenance, which in turn reduces opportunism.

  • Purpose - This study examined the effect of perceived corporate social responsibility (CSR) on cognitive trust, emotional trust, and loyalty among using Korean food buffet franchises. The result of this study is expected to provide practical implication to industry practitioners in expanding their understanding of the CSR effect in the marketing perspective. Research design, data, and methodology - The data was collected from a panel of online research companies who are over 20 years old and dined in at Korean style buffet franchise outlets more than five times. A total of 370 samples were used after eliminating outliers and missing data. the data were analyzed SEM with SPSS and AMOS. Result - The result of this study showed that: 1) social CSR activities have an effect only on emotional trust; 2) food-related CSR activities influence both cognitive trust and emotional trust; and 3) both cognitive trust and emotional trust have a significant impact on customer loyalty in Korean style buffet franchises. However, it is important to note that this study found no significant causal impact from environmental CSR activities. Furthermore, this study found that food-related CSR activities have the greater influence on the cognitive trust, and cognitive trust is more influential on the customer loyalty than the emotional trust. Conclusions - Based on the findings, this study provides practical implications to industry practitioners. First, that CSR has a significant impact on customer trust suggests that Korean style buffet franchises should focus on CSR activities to improve customer trust. Second, that food-related CSR activities have the greater influence on the cognitive trust implies that industry practitioners should reinforce food-related CSR activities as a marketing tool to enhance emotional trust and the overall credibility of their franchise. Third, we need to find CSR measures at the social level that can secure emotional trust so that customer loyalty can be formed. Fourth, Korean food buffet franchise food service companies should concentrate their efforts on CSR activities at food and social level among the three dimensions suggested by researchers in order to form customer loyalty. For next study, perceived concept of CSR on individual customer should be examined.
